In this paper, the authors wanted to analyse the behaviour of fractional order system under relay control. There is a brief introduction to finding a solution for non-integer order systems both with zero and non-zero initial conditions. Then, the numerical approach is presented with some examples.

Applying the selective harmonic elimination (SHE) technique to grid connected cascaded modular multilevel inverters has been widely discussed in literature. However, due to the difficulties of solving high-order non-linear transcendental equations, the SHE technique cannot be implemented in real time so its applications are limited. Multi-terminal High Voltage dc Transmission (MTDC) is used to reduce the power losses over two distant regions. It is difficult for typical three level inverters to reach the desired dc bus voltage levels, e.g. > 500 kV, due to the large voltage stress on each switch and switching transients. Wide-range load variations in resonant power conversion systems can lead to loss of unity power factor at the output of a switching inverter stage, increasing the circulating reactive energy through the switches and power loss. In order to overcome the solar energy harvesting problem caused by photovoltaic (PV) panel mismatches, Distributed Maximum Power Point Tracking (DMPPT) architectures can be found in the literature. In these PV architectures, there is a DC-DC converter per PV panel, which has the function of operating the PV panel at its maximum power point (MPP).
